Caroline Andresen's Obituary
Caroline M. Andresen, 98, of Camanche, passed away, Thursday, July 3, 2025 at the Alverno.
Funeral Services will be 11:00am, Thursday, July 10, 2025, at St. John’s Lutheran Church – Clinton. Burial will be in the Rose Hill Cemetery. Serving as pallbearers will be her grandchildren: Cory Goldbeck, Joe Goldbeck, Lyndon Andresen, Erin Phillips, Misti Steiner, LeNee Andresen. Visitation will be Thursday from 9:30am to the service time at the church. The Snell-Zornig Funeral Homes & Crematory – Camanche is assisting the family.
Caroline Mardele Jahn was born on September 17, 1926, in Thomson, Illinois, the daughter of Herman and Marie (Hoffmann) Jahn. She was a 1944 graduate of Clinton High School. She married George Andresen on April 17, 1949, in Charlotte, Iowa, he passed away on May 25, 2016.
Caroline was a homemaker and was a member of St. John’s Lutheran Church. She will be remembered for being a great cook, artist, poetry writer, and her love for animals. Most of all she enjoyed spending time with her family.
Caroline is survived by her four sons: Lon Andresen of Camanche, Loren (Peggy) Andresen of Camanche, Dean (Sue) Andresen of Green Bay, Wisconsin, and Dwight (Cheryle) Andresen of Mountain Home, Idaho; a daughter-in-law: Gina Andresen of Clinton; 6 grandchildren and 18 great-grandchildren and 2 great-great grandchildren.
In addition of her husband she was preceded in death by her parents, a son Lyle, a grandson Landis, four brothers and five sisters.
The family would like to express their gratitude to the nurses and staff of the Alverno and Mercy Hospice. Memorials can be made to St. John’s Lutheran Church or the Clinton Humane Society.
